Oxford Spring School UK City Futures

Event type: UT
Date: 04/05/2017

The “cities agenda” in the UK has undergone major changes of late. The new government’s priorities for restructuring the British model of growth will foreground the roles of cities in shaping the UK’s economic future in the Industrial Strategies Challenge Fund. Research ‘on’ and ‘in’ cities has never shown greater potential in interdisciplinary capacity, a potential not always realised in the architecture of the UK’s traditionally specialised discipline oriented research council funding structures.

This symposium seeks to combine the policy and research conversations over 2 days at an intensive “Spring School” of invited delegates in Oxford and to share insights from the urban transformations team and the extended community developing the new cities research. It seeks to set an agenda for policy engaged, future facing urban work within and beyond the University of Oxford that directly addresses the emergent agenda of the Industrial Strategy Challenge Fund and the new research and innovation ecosystem.
